Annex I will always have security coverage at 9:00pm for the identification check-in process. During most evening hours, there are two security employees working the identification check-in process. When there are unexpected absences, there will only be one. However, the student CSO is a representative of the security force and was on duty for the 9:00pm check-in. There was coverage on Thursday night. An additional Security Officer started at 10pm and coverage continued until 8am.
If overnight security coverage is not available, everyone will be notified and the Library Annex will be closed. Before that happens, however, every effort will be made to get security coverage.
FYI: Being employed by the University Police there are many duties required of the Community Service Officers throughout the day and night. The Library Annex is not a stationary post and we’re often requested, by University Police, to perform our responsibilities outside of Annex I. However, there is always a security officer after 10pm and one remains in the Annex until 8:00am.
